It is from the book “Don’t Be Sad” , which is written by Dr Aaidh ibn Abdullah al- Qarni. ( By the way, if you have not read this book yet- I advise you to get a copy of it as soon as possible and read it. It has endless advice and it contains so much wisdom within it. It is one of my favourite books.)
“TITLE: THE PAST IS GONE FOREVER:
By brooding over the past and its tragedies, one exhibits a form of insanity – a kind of sickness that destroys resolve to live for the present moment. Those who have a firm purpose have filed away and forgotten occurrences of the past, which will never again see light, since they occupy a dark place in the recesses of the mind. Episodes of the past are finished with; sadness cannot retrieve them, melancholy cannot make things right, and depression will never bring the past back to life . This is because the past is non-existent.
Reading too much in the past is a waste of the present. When Allah mentioned the affairs of the previous nations,He, the Exalted ,said:
[ That was a nation who passed away.] (Qur’an 2:134)
Former days are gone and done with, and you benefit nothing by carrying out an autopsy over them , by turning back the wheels of history.”
